H3: Time is Money

One of the most significant reasons landlords are switching to managed services is the time savings they yield. Self-managing rental properties can involve tedious tasks including:
– Guest communication
– Cleaning logistics
– Marketing and promotions
– Maintenance coordination

Landlords who opt for managed services can delegate these responsibilities to professionals who specialise in short-term rentals. By doing so, they free up valuable time that can be better spent on other pursuits, whether that be further investments or personal leisure.

H2: Quality Tenants Over Quantity

In today’s market, it’s not just about the number of bookings but the quality of those stays. Weekend party guests, while sometimes enticing, can lead to increased wear and tear and ultimately higher costs for landlords. In contrast, contractor and corporate stays offer stability.

H3: Reduced Wear and Tear

Properties rented to professionals tend to come with different expectations and care. By engaging in fewer high-turnover bookings with transient guests, landlords can expect:
– Less wear on property fixtures
– More consistent maintenance schedules
– Overall higher property value retention

Utilising managed services often means a focus on stabilising rental income through longer stays which lessens the likelihood of damage and provides landlords with peace of mind.
